Compartir a través de


Tipo de recurso macOSPkcsCertificateProfile

Espacio de nombres: microsoft.graph

Importante: Las API de Microsoft Graph en la versión /beta están sujetas a cambios; no se admite el uso de producción.

Nota: la API de Microsoft Graph para Intune requiere una licencia activa de Intune para el espacio empresarial.

Perfil de certificado PKCS de MacOS.

Hereda de macOSCertificateProfileBase

Métodos

Método Tipo de valor devuelto Descripción
Enumerar macOSPkcsCertificateProfiles colección macOSPkcsCertificateProfile Enumera las propiedades y las relaciones de los objetos macOSPkcsCertificateProfile .
Obtener macOSPkcsCertificateProfile macOSPkcsCertificateProfile Lea las propiedades y las relaciones del objeto macOSPkcsCertificateProfile .
Creación de macOSPkcsCertificateProfile macOSPkcsCertificateProfile Cree un nuevo objeto macOSPkcsCertificateProfile .
Eliminar macOSPkcsCertificateProfile Ninguno Elimina un macOSPkcsCertificateProfile.
Actualizar macOSPkcsCertificateProfile macOSPkcsCertificateProfile Actualice las propiedades de un objeto macOSPkcsCertificateProfile .

Propiedades

Propiedad Tipo Descripción
id Cadena Clave de la entidad. Heredado de deviceConfiguration
lastModifiedDateTime DateTimeOffset Fecha y hora en la que se modificó el objeto por última vez. Heredado de deviceConfiguration
roleScopeTagIds Colección string Lista de etiquetas de ámbito para esta instancia de entity. Heredado de deviceConfiguration
supportsScopeTags Booleano Indica si la configuración de dispositivo subyacente admite o no la asignación de etiquetas de ámbito. No se permite asignar a la propiedad ScopeTags cuando este valor es false y las entidades no serán visibles para los usuarios con ámbito. Esto ocurre para las directivas heredadas creadas en Silverlight y se pueden resolver mediante la eliminación y la recreación de la directiva en Azure Portal. Esta propiedad es de sólo lectura. Heredado de deviceConfiguration
deviceManagementApplicabilityRuleOsEdition deviceManagementApplicabilityRuleOsEdition Aplicabilidad de la edición del sistema operativo para esta directiva. Heredado de deviceConfiguration
deviceManagementApplicabilityRuleOsVersion deviceManagementApplicabilityRuleOsVersion Regla de aplicabilidad de la versión del sistema operativo para esta directiva. Heredado de deviceConfiguration
deviceManagementApplicabilityRuleDeviceMode deviceManagementApplicabilityRuleDeviceMode Regla de aplicabilidad del modo de dispositivo para esta directiva. Heredado de deviceConfiguration
createdDateTime DateTimeOffset Fecha y hora en la que se creó el objeto. Heredado de deviceConfiguration
description Cadena Descripción proporcionada por el administrador de la configuración del dispositivo. Heredado de deviceConfiguration
displayName Cadena Nombre proporcionado por el administrador de la configuración del dispositivo. Heredado de deviceConfiguration
version Int32 Versión de la configuración del dispositivo. Heredado de deviceConfiguration
renewalThresholdPercentage Int32 Porcentaje de umbral de renovación de certificados. Heredado de macOSCertificateProfileBase
subjectNameFormat appleSubjectNameFormat Formato de nombre del firmante del certificado. Se hereda de macOSCertificateProfileBase. Los valores posibles son: commonName, commonNameAsEmail, custom, commonNameIncludingEmail, commonNameAsIMEI, commonNameAsSerialNumber.
subjectAlternativeNameType subjectAlternativeNameType Tipo de nombre alternativo del firmante del certificado. Se hereda de macOSCertificateProfileBase. Los valores posibles son: none, emailAddress, userPrincipalName, customAzureADAttribute, domainNameService, universalResourceIdentifier.
certificateValidityPeriodValue Int32 Valor del período de validez del certificado. Heredado de macOSCertificateProfileBase
certificateValidityPeriodScale certificateValidityPeriodScale Escale para el período de validez del certificado. Se hereda de macOSCertificateProfileBase. Los valores posibles son: days, months y years.
certificationAuthority Cadena FQDN de la entidad de certificación PKCS.
certificationAuthorityName Cadena Nombre de la entidad de certificación PKCS.
certificateTemplateName Cadena Nombre de plantilla de certificado PKCS.
subjectAlternativeNameFormatString Cadena Formato de cadena que define el nombre alternativo del firmante.
subjectNameFormatString Cadena Formato de cadena que define el nombre del firmante. Ejemplo: CN={{EmailAddress}},E={{EmailAddress}},OU=Usuarios empresariales,O=Contoso Corporation,L=Redmond,ST=WA,C=US
certificateStore certificateStore Certificado de almacén de destino. Los valores posibles son user y machine.
customSubjectAlternativeNames colección customSubjectAlternativeName Configuración del nombre alternativo del firmante personalizado. Esta colección puede contener un máximo de 500 elementos.
allowAllAppsAccess Booleano Configuración de AllowAllAppsAccess
deploymentChannel appleDeploymentChannel Indica el tipo de canal de implementación usado para implementar el perfil de configuración. Los valores posibles son deviceChannel, userChannel. Los valores posibles son: deviceChannel, userChannel y unknownFutureValue.

Relaciones

Relación Tipo Descripción
groupAssignments colección deviceConfigurationGroupAssignment La lista de asignaciones de grupo para el perfil de configuración del dispositivo. Heredado de deviceConfiguration
assignments Colección deviceConfigurationAssignment La lista de tareas para el perfil de configuración del dispositivo. Heredado de deviceConfiguration
deviceStatuses Colección deviceConfigurationDeviceStatus Estado de instalación de configuración del dispositivo por dispositivo. Heredado de deviceConfiguration
userStatuses Colección deviceConfigurationUserStatus Estado de instalación de la configuración del dispositivo por usuario. Heredado de deviceConfiguration
deviceStatusOverview deviceConfigurationDeviceOverview Información general sobre el estado de dispositivos de la configuración de dispositivo. Heredado de deviceConfiguration
userStatusOverview deviceConfigurationUserOverview Información general sobre el estado de usuarios de la configuración de dispositivo. Heredado de deviceConfiguration
deviceSettingStateSummaries Colección settingStateDeviceSummary Resumen de dispositivo sobre el estado de configuración de la configuración de dispositivo. Heredado de deviceConfiguration
managedDeviceCertificateStates colección managedDeviceCertificateState Estado del certificado para dispositivos. Esta colección puede contener un máximo de 2147483647 elementos.

Representación JSON

Aquí tiene una representación JSON del recurso.

{
  "@odata.type": "#microsoft.graph.macOSPkcsCertificateProfile",
  "id": "String (identifier)",
  "lastModifiedDateTime": "String (timestamp)",
  "roleScopeTagIds": [
    "String"
  ],
  "supportsScopeTags": true,
  "deviceManagementApplicabilityRuleOsEdition": {
    "@odata.type": "microsoft.graph.deviceManagementApplicabilityRuleOsEdition",
    "osEditionTypes": [
      "String"
    ],
    "name": "String",
    "ruleType": "String"
  },
  "deviceManagementApplicabilityRuleOsVersion": {
    "@odata.type": "microsoft.graph.deviceManagementApplicabilityRuleOsVersion",
    "minOSVersion": "String",
    "maxOSVersion": "String",
    "name": "String",
    "ruleType": "String"
  },
  "deviceManagementApplicabilityRuleDeviceMode": {
    "@odata.type": "microsoft.graph.deviceManagementApplicabilityRuleDeviceMode",
    "deviceMode": "String",
    "name": "String",
    "ruleType": "String"
  },
  "createdDateTime": "String (timestamp)",
  "description": "String",
  "displayName": "String",
  "version": 1024,
  "renewalThresholdPercentage": 1024,
  "subjectNameFormat": "String",
  "subjectAlternativeNameType": "String",
  "certificateValidityPeriodValue": 1024,
  "certificateValidityPeriodScale": "String",
  "certificationAuthority": "String",
  "certificationAuthorityName": "String",
  "certificateTemplateName": "String",
  "subjectAlternativeNameFormatString": "String",
  "subjectNameFormatString": "String",
  "certificateStore": "String",
  "customSubjectAlternativeNames": [
    {
      "@odata.type": "microsoft.graph.customSubjectAlternativeName",
      "sanType": "String",
      "name": "String"
    }
  ],
  "allowAllAppsAccess": true,
  "deploymentChannel": "String"
}